|
|
| version 1.1, 2004/08/10 14:38:57 | version 1.2, 2005/02/07 16:09:19 |
|---|---|
| Line 1 | Line 1 |
| #include "compiler.h" | #include "compiler.h" |
| #include "strres.h" | #include "strres.h" |
| #include "resource.h" | #include "resource.h" |
| #include "np2.h" | #include "xmil.h" |
| #include "dosio.h" | #include "dosio.h" |
| #include "sysmng.h" | #include "sysmng.h" |
| #include "dialog.h" | #include "dialog.h" |
| Line 9 | Line 9 |
| #include "pccore.h" | #include "pccore.h" |
| #include "iocore.h" | #include "iocore.h" |
| #include "scrnsave.h" | #include "scrnsave.h" |
| #include "font.h" | |
| void dialog_font(void) { | |
| char path[MAX_PATH]; | |
| if (dlgs_selectfile(path, sizeof(path))) { | |
| if (font_load(path, FALSE)) { | |
| gdcs.textdisp |= GDCSCRN_ALLDRAW2; | |
| milstr_ncpy(np2cfg.fontfile, path, sizeof(np2cfg.fontfile)); | |
| sysmng_update(SYS_UPDATECFG); | |
| } | |
| } | |
| } | |
| void dialog_writebmp(void) { | void dialog_writebmp(void) { |
| SCRNSAVE ss; | SCRNSAVE ss; |
| Line 35 const char *ext; | Line 21 const char *ext; |
| if (ss == NULL) { | if (ss == NULL) { |
| return; | return; |
| } | } |
| if (dlgs_selectwritefile(path, sizeof(path), "np2.bmp")) { | if (dlgs_selectwritefile(path, sizeof(path), "xmil.bmp", FTYPE_BMP, hWndMain)) { |
| ext = file_getext(path); | ext = file_getext(path); |
| if ((ss->type <= SCRNSAVE_8BIT) && | if ((ss->type <= SCRNSAVE_8BIT) && |
| (!file_cmpname(ext, "gif"))) { | (!file_cmpname(ext, "gif"))) { |